How adoption works

Four steps. No hoops.

Apply

Ten minutes by email, read the same week. No, you do not need a fenced yard. You need a plan.

Meet

At the Saturday meet and greet, or in the foster home. Bring the kids and your current dog. Everyone votes.

Home visit

A short walk-through, usually the same week. We are checking fit, not furniture. Apartment people do great here.

Gotcha day

Sign, pay the fee, and go home with a starter bag, the vet records, and our phone number forever.

  • Dogs$250
  • Puppies, under one year$325
  • Cats$150
  • Seniors, eight and up$75
  • Bonded pairssecond fee halved

What the fee covers

Every animal goes home vaccinated, spayed or neutered, microchipped, and seen by our vet at least twice. The fee covers roughly half of that. Donations cover the rest, so nobody profits and nobody haggles.

If the fee is the only thing between a senior pet and a good home, write to us. We would rather talk than let Duke wait.

Foster

Every foster home opens a kennel.

We have no building full of runs. Our capacity is exactly the number of spare rooms and forgiving couches people lend us. Foster one animal and we can say yes to the next intake call.

What it involves

A dog: two walks, meals, and a couch. A cat: a quiet room and patience. Your photos and honest notes are how we match adopters.

What we cover

All vet care, food, a crate, a litter box, and a 24-hour line to people who have seen everything. Your only cost is electricity for the heating pad.

The two-week trial

Try one two-week stay. If it is not for you, we come get them, no questions asked, and thank you anyway. Most people ask for a second.

Ask about fostering

Fair warning: about a third of our foster homes adopt their first placement. We count every one as a win.
